The mags for the Standard can be created from later versions by simply moving their follower buttons to the other side--except those for the .45 style frame, which have a bottom that prevents their fit. The older 9-shot mags can be modified to hold ten rounds by shortening the tip of the internal stop enough to hold the extra round. |
